This was a last minute choice at the cinema after having missed the film we actually wanted to see (Stardust). This film was under comedy; we wanted to laugh.

And we did. I was pleasantly surprised. The plot of this film was great - original ideas. Some of it was rather predictable at times, but that didn't matter overall. It wasn't too long, nor too short. A good dose of humour muxed in with some serious situations.

If only all funerals turned out this amusing...
